How Much Is My Fraud Case Worth in Modesto?

Understanding the value of your fraud case in Modesto can involve several factors. Here are key elements to consider:

Type and Severity of Fraud

– Financial fraud cases can range in complexity and severity, impacting the case value.

– Consider whether your case involves identity theft, credit card fraud, insurance fraud, or another type of fraud.

Economic Damages

– Compensation for actual financial losses, including restitution of stolen funds or property.

– This can also include potential future earnings lost due to the fraudulent act.

Potential Outcomes and Compensation

Settlement Opportunities

– Many fraud cases settle outside of court; understanding settlement ranges is crucial.

– A fair and timely settlement can be beneficial in certain circumstances.

Punitive Damages

– In cases with malicious intent, additional punitive damages might be granted.

– Used to deter future fraudulent actions by the defendant.

Understanding the Worth of a Fraud Case in Modesto

Determining the worth of a fraud case in Modesto involves a comprehensive evaluation of various factors, each contributing to the potential compensation you might receive. As fraud cases range from minor to complex claims, understanding these factors is essential. This article outlines the key considerations to help evaluate your fraud case’s potential worth.

First and foremost, the type and severity of fraud committed play a crucial role in assessing a case’s value. Cases involving large monetary losses, significant harm to reputation, or intricate schemes typically warrant higher compensation. In contrast, less severe instances may result in lower settlements or verdicts.

Additionally, the extent of damages incurred is pivotal in determining a fraud case’s worth. These damages may include financial losses, emotional distress, and legal fees. Documenting and proving these damages effectively can enhance the potential compensation you might receive. Legal expertise from an attorney specializing in fraud cases can aid in robustly presenting your damages.

Furthermore, the role of evidence cannot be overstated. Solid evidence underpinning the fraud, such as paper trails, digital records, or eyewitness testimonies, strengthens your case significantly. The stronger the evidence, the more likely a favorable judgment or settlement becomes, potentially increasing your case’s worth.
